Condition: Lung Cancer (Diagnosis) · Sponsor: Tri-Service General Hospital (TSGH)
This randomized trial will test whether Antrodia cinnamomea supplement improves quality of life in lung cancer patients receiving platinum-based chemotherapy. Participants at Tri-Service General Hospital will be randomized to receive either Antrodia cinnamomea capsules or placebo for 3 months, with follow-up to 6 months (24 weeks). Primary outcomes include nausea/vomiting scores, sleep quality, quality of life, and cancer symptoms.
